Strontium nitrate (cas 10042-76-9) as a stable and potential anode material for lithium ion batteries

A novel anode candidate, Sr(NO3)2, has been studied as a potential host material in lithium-ion batteries. The phase composition, particle morphology and lithium storage capability of Sr(NO3)2 have been thoroughly investigated. Sr(NO3)2,could maintain its reversible charge capacity at 237.3 mA h g−1 along with a high capacity retention of 99.08% at 50 mA g−1. Furthermore, it shows excellent cycling stability even at higher current density. Cycled at 500 mA g−1, it can deliver an initial charge capacity of 103.0 mA h g−1 kept at 100.9 mA h g−1 after 500 cycles. Compared with other nitrates that have been reported before, Sr(NO3)2 proved to have a better capacity retention capability at low and high rates. The high stable electrochemical performance can be ascribed to the absence of crystal water in its structure. Most importantly, commercial Sr(NO3)2 in this work just needs to be ground uniformly before its use as anode material and does not need complicated pretreatment like doping, carbon coating, calcination or nanocrystallization.
